Output 532a6ebbe4af8519de131bdcd88eb9a445100eb3a501266f1bc6e50fca795c21:0

value
4124544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d3b6d0d89ace7ea42fa30015205c1c0f3d5ca2 OP_EQUAL
address
31mPYhVfSFXvk8XGtADGtPhLPmdtoWQakz
transaction
532a6ebbe4af8519de131bdcd88eb9a445100eb3a501266f1bc6e50fca795c21
spent
true